site stats

Bitmask lowest bit

WebSep 16, 2015 · Suppose we have a collection of elements which are numbered from 1 to N. If we want to represent a subset of this set then it can be encoded by a sequence of N … WebHow it works. =BITAND (1,5) Compares the binary representations of 1 and 5. 1. The binary representation of 1 is 1, and the binary representation of 5 is 101. Their bits match only at the rightmost position. This is returned as 2^0, or 1. =BITAND (13,25) Compares the binary representations of 13 and 25.

Algorithm 高效地找到与位掩码匹配的第一个元 …

WebFrom: Avi Kivity To: [email protected] Cc: [email protected] Subject: [PATCH 24/43] KVM: APIC: get rid of deliver_bitmask … how is a heart rate measured https://slk-tour.com

How to bitmask a number (in hex) using the AND operator?

WebApr 3, 2024 · Suppose we have a collection of elements which are numbered from 1 to N. If we want to represent a subset of this set then it can be encoded by a sequence of N bits (we usually call this sequence a “mask”). In our chosen subset the i-th element belongs to it if and only if the i-th bit of the mask is set i.e., it equals to 1. WebFeb 7, 2024 · Unsigned right-shift operator >>> Available in C# 11 and later, the >>> operator shifts its left-hand operand right by the number of bits defined by its right-hand operand. For information about how the right-hand operand defines the shift count, see the Shift count of the shift operators section.. The >>> operator always performs a logical … WebOct 7, 2011 · 3. I'm writing ARM assembly code that at some point has to set a single bit of a register to 1. This is best done of course via "register- or -bitmask" method. However, according to ARM documentation, the Assembly ORR command (bitwise OR) does not take immediate values. In other words you can only bitwise-OR a value in one register with a … high in b vitamins

c - How do I get the lower 8 bits of an int? - Stack Overflow

Category:O.3 — Bit manipulation with bitwise operators and bit masks

Tags:Bitmask lowest bit

Bitmask lowest bit

Bitmask and Bit Manipulation - TheAlgorist

WebBitmask and Bit Manipulation. A Bitmask is data that is used for bitwise operations, particularly in a bit field. Using a bitmask, multiple bits in a byte can be set either turned … WebAug 28, 2024 · A mask defines which bits you want to keep, and which bits you want to clear. Masking is the act of applying a mask to a value. This is accomplished by doing: Below is an example of extracting a subset of the bits in the value: Applying the mask to …

Bitmask lowest bit

Did you know?

WebMay 1, 2024 · Assume we have a bitmask, say 64 bits. A simple way to find the lowest 0 bit, would be to do a logical bit & operation with the mask 0x0001 and shift the above mask to the left whenever the result is 1. This is a linear time complexity in the number of bits, O (n). I wonder if you can achieve a faster execution than the naive iterative approach ... WebOf course, both can be easily concated to get the position of the lowest bit not set. The code works as follows: ~ x turns all 0's into 1's (and vice versa). This gives us a nice …

http://duoduokou.com/algorithm/50707106429952962093.html WebJul 22, 2015 · Bit masking allows you to use operations that work on bit-level. Editing particular bits in a byte (s) Checking if particular bit values are present or not. You actually apply a mask to a value, where in our case the value is our state 00000101 and the mask is again a binary number, which indicates the bits of interest.

WebPython bitwise operators are defined for the following built-in data types: int. bool. set and frozenset. dict (since Python 3.9) It’s not a widely known fact, but bitwise operators can perform operations from set algebra, such as … WebPython bitwise operators are defined for the following built-in data types: int. bool. set and frozenset. dict (since Python 3.9) It’s not a widely known fact, but bitwise operators can perform operations from set algebra, …

WebSep 26, 2024 · On a 4 bit processor, it can make the processor 4x faster. On an 8 bit process, or it can make it 8x faster (on bitwise operations alone, of course). One fascinating use for this is chess engines. The Chess …

WebFeb 22, 2024 · Bit flags make the most sense when you have many identical flag variables. For example, in the example above, imagine that instead of having one person (me), you had 100. If you used 8 Booleans per person (one for each possible state), you’d use 800 bytes of memory. With bit flags, you’d use 8 bytes for the bit masks, and 100 bytes for … how is a heart attack diagnosedWebAlgorithm 高效地找到与位掩码匹配的第一个元素,algorithm,search,optimization,data-structures,bitmask,Algorithm,Search,Optimization,Data Structures,Bitmask,我有一个N64位整数的列表,其位表示小集合。 high in californiaWebUse the bitwise OR operator ( ) to set a bit. number = 1UL << n; That will set the n th bit of number. n should be zero, if you want to set the 1 st bit and so on upto n-1, if you want to set the n th bit. Use 1ULL if number is wider than unsigned long; promotion of 1UL << n doesn't happen until after evaluating 1UL << n where it's undefined ... how is a heart stent installedWebFeb 22, 2024 · Bit flags make the most sense when you have many identical flag variables. For example, in the example above, imagine that instead of having one person (me), you … high in calcium foods recipesWebOct 14, 2014 · Masking is done by setting all the bits except the one(s) you want to 0. So let's say you have a 8 bit variable and you want to check if the 5th bit from the is a 1. Let's say your variable is 00101100. To mask all the other bits we set all the bits except the 5th one to 0 using the & operator: 00101100 & 00010000 high in california louis tomlinson lyricsWebJun 2, 2015 · First, we need to make a few minor adjustments to the original code: It does not make sense to have a permission value of 0 since 0 means "no permissions".; The "BitNum" is not the direct value that you use in the POWER function. If you need a "bit" value of 1, that comes from raising 2 to the power of 0.So you need to subtract 1 from … how is a heart catheterization performedWebApr 8, 2016 · Bits aren't given numeric positions. Instead we speak of the least significant bit (LSB) and the most significant bit. Unfortunately, in general things aren't that simple. The … high in california louis tomlinson